Patient Group Directions (PGDs)

Submission of PGD Authorisation Forms
As of September 1st 2025, we have moved to a new electronic system of PGD recording. Pharmacists are asked now to complete one MS form to confirm that they have completed the correct version of the agreement form, have signed and dated it before storing within the pharmacy.
There is now no need to submit individual PGD agreement forms to the aa.cpteam@aapct.scot.nhs.uk inbox.

Please use this Electronic Submission Form to declare agreement to the below PGDs.

Contractors should ensure that all pharmacists and locums they employ are aware of the services you are contractually obliged to provide. Contracted services must be provided during contracted opening hours. Pharmacists and locums must be legally covered to provide services by completing the mandatory training required as indicated in the PGD and signing the individual authorisation.
